Remoraid is a water-type pokémon that first appeared in Generation II. It evolves into Octillery at level 25.
Contents |
[edit] Biology
[edit] Physiology
Remoraid is a light blue fish Pokémon. It is very small, and has two darker blue stripes on its back. It has two eyes on the side of its head, and four small teeth. It also has two small hand-like fins, and also two tail-like fins. It also has one thicker-looking fin coming out of its head.
[edit] Gender Differences
Remoraid does not have any gender differences.
